PROCEDURE
实验过程
A mixture of 8-(2,6-dichloro-3,5-dimethoxy-phenyl)-quinoxaline-5-carboxylic acid (300 mg, 0.791 mmol) (Step 179.1), 2-amino-4-diethoxymethyl-imidazole-1-carboxylic acid tert-butyl ester (226 mg, 0.791 mmol) (Step 179.8), TBTU (305 mg, 0.949 mmol, 1.2 equiv) and DIEA (409 mg, 3.17 mmol, 4 equiv) in DMF (6 mL) was stirred for 48 h at rt. After further addition of 2-amino-4-diethoxymethyl-imidazole-1-carboxylic acid tert-butyl ester (80 mg, 0.280 mmol) (Step 179.8), the reaction mixture was stirred for additional 72 h at rt, diluted with EtOAc/H2O and extracted with EtOAc. The organic phase was washed with H2O and brine, dried (Na2SO4), filtered and concentrated. The residue was purified by silica gel column chromatography (EtOAc/Hex, 1:1) to afford 470 ring of a mixture of products. Part of this mixture (280 mg) was dissolved in acetone (3 mL) and H2O (2 mL) and treated with PPTS (10.9 mg). The reaction mixture was stirred for 7 h at rt, heated to 50° C., stirred for 20 h, allowed to cool to rt and diluted with EtOAc/H2O. The resulting yellow precipitate was collected by vacuum filtration and dried to provide 128 mg of the title compound: ES-MS: 472 [M+H]+; tR=4.16 min (System 1).
